Drumroll please… “School holiday” in Spanish is “vacaciones escolares” (vah-kah-see-OH-nays es-coh-LAR-ays). But hold up – just like English, Spanish has different flavors of this phrase depending on context. For example:
“Receso escolar” = Schulpause/kurze Pause
“Periodo vacacional” = Urlaubszeit
“Descanso académico” = Akademische Pause (formeller)
Profi-Tipp: In lockeren Gesprächen sagen die meisten Spanischsprachigen einfach “vacaciones de la escuela” (Schulferien).

Q: Is “vacaciones” only for long breaks?
A: Great question! While “vacaciones” implies longer breaks (like summer), for random days off Spaniards might say “día festivo” (Feiertag) oder “puente” (langes Wochenende Brücke).

Q: How do you say “summer vacation” specifically?
A: Das wäre “vacaciones de verano” – though in some countries it’s called “vacaciones estivales” (ausgefallener akademischer Begriff).
